Help Lindsay beat this brain tumourMany people would have heard the news from NSW.Just to make this clear this is the same process and scheme available already in Queensland since December last year.This scheme is for doctors and specialists to apply for patients to be prescribed legal medical cannabis through the TGA Special Access Scheme for "TGA unapproved products not registered on the ARTG" but coming from a licenced supplier(which don't exist in Australia yet).Having gone through this process in Queensland already I can confirm that it is also a time consuming process which involves unnecessary delays and risks for patients who have to endure the waits for medicines.Because two applications are involved (Federal and State) and the medicines have to be sourced from a licenced producer (currently only overseas), it becomes a very long and protracted process.The patient's doctor or specialist has to apply through the TGA Special Access Scheme and also apply to the state through a state application process.Gaining approvals for CBD medicines only is a lot faster than anything containing more THC for example because different scheduling restrictions and processes that are in place.It is simply lots of media spin. In Queensland for example the government we believe intentionally tried to keep this regulatory change quiet and low key, maybe they didn't want to open the floodgates, maybe they weren't ready for that and maybe it all happened outside of their timeline due to legal processes that we had started.In NSW the government have chosen to scream it from the rooftops giving the misconception that its all just legal and simple when it is far from that and still involved a time consuming process with significant delays waiting for imports!Both of these state programmes The Queensland one and the NSW one are definitely far from ideal for patients suffering! But they do offer a legal option and patients and doctors can recommend any product that they believe that patient could benefit from just like the Qld programme. Anything from Cannabis skin patches to botanical full extract oils, to tinctures to dried bud for vaporisation.
